Summary
Provides statistical data in easy to use tables, for the last 254 years (where available) of every country in the American continent, covering: -- Population & Vital Statistics -- Labour Force -- Agriculture -- Industry -- External Trade -- Transport & Communication -- Prices -- Education -- National Accounts.
